R s M Lath: All lath and lath attachments shall be of corrosion -resistant materials. Expanded metal or woven wire lath shall be attached with 1 1/2 -inch -long (38 mm), 11 gage nails having a 7/16 -inch (11.1 mm) head, or 7/8 -inch- long (22.2 mm), 16 gage staples, spaced at no more than 6 inches (152 mm). Water -resistive barriers: Water -resistive barriers shall be installed as required in Section R703.2 and, where applied over wood -based sheathing, shall include a water -resistive vapor -permeable barrier with a performance at least equivalent to two layers of Grade D paper. The individual layers shall be installed independently such as each layer provides separate continuous plane and any flashing (installed in accordance with Section R703.8) intended to drain to the water -resistive barrier is directly between the layers. Exception: Where the water -resistive barrier that is applied over wood -based sheathing has a water resistance equal to or greater than that of 60 -minute Grade D paper and is separated from stucco by an intervening, substantially nonwater-absorbing layer or designed drainage space. UNDERLAYMENT APPLICATION: FOR ROOF SLOPES FROM TWO UNITS VERTICAL IN 12 UNITS HORIZONTAL (17 -PERCENT SLOPE), UP TO 4 UNITS VERTICAL IN 12 UNITS HORIZONTAL (33 -PERCENT SLOPE), UNDERLAYMENT SHALL BE 2 LAYERS APPLIED IN THE FOLLOWING MANNER. APPLY A 19" FELT (483MM) STRIP OF UNDERLAYMENT FELT PARALLEL WITH AND STARTING AT THE EAVES, FASTENED SUFFICIENTLY TO HOLD IN PLACE, STARTING AT THE EAVE, APPLY 36" WIDE (914MM) SHEETS OF UNDERLAYMENT, OVERLAPPING SUCCESSIVE SHEETS 1911(483MM), AND FASTENED SUFFICIENTLY TO HOLD IN PLACE.DISTORTIONS IN THE UNDERLAYMENT SHALL NOT INTERFERE WITH THE ABILITY OF THE SHINGLES TO SEAL. FOR ROOF SLOPES OF FOUR UNITS VERTICAL IN 12 UNITS HORIZONTAL (33 -PERCENT) OR GREATER, UNDERLAYMENT SHALL BE ONE LAYER APPLIED IN THE FOLLOWING MANNER. UNDERLAYMENT SHALL BE APPLIED SHINGLE FASHION, PARALLEL TO AND STARTING FROM THE EAVE AND LAPPED 2 INCHES (51 MM), FASTENED SUFFICIENTLY TO HOLD IN PLACE. DISTORTIONS IN THE UNDERLAYMENT SHALL NOT INTERFERE WITH THE ABILITY OF THE SHINGLES TO SEAL. END LAPS SHALL BE OFFSET BY 6 FEET (I829MM). VENT CALCULATION; 1,244 S.F. OF ROOF AREA 1,2441150 = 9 S.F.
